Aslamul Haque (14 May 1961 – 4 April 2021)[1] was a Bangladeshi entrepreneur, businessman and politician. He was a Bangladesh Awami League politician and Jatiya Sangsad member from Dhaka-14 constituency since its inception in 2008[2] until his death in 2021.

Career

Haque was the founder and chairman of Maisha Group, a business conglomerate in Bangladesh. He began building his business in 1992. Maisha Group began as Maisha Property Development Ltd.[3] He was the member of Commonwealth of Independent States-Bangladesh Chamber of Commerce and Industry.[4][5][6] Maisha Group developed Arisha Private Economic Zone in Dhaka.[7]

Controversy

In March 2020, Bangladesh Inland Water Transport Authority sought to demolish apparent illegal structures owned by Haque in Dhaka. They demolished parts of a power plant owned by him.[8]
